STAT3 Silencing by an Aptamer-Based Strategy Hampers the Crosstalk between NSCLC Cells and Cancer-Associated Fibroblasts

Scientists applied an aptamer-based conjugate, containing a signal transducer and activator of transcription-3 (STAT3) siRNA linked to an aptamer binding and inhibiting the platelet-derived growth factor receptor β, to obtain STAT3 specific silencing and interfere with CAF pro-tumorigenic functions.
